Navarro Research and Engineering is recruiting a Supply Chain Field Organization Program Manager in Oak Ridge, TN

Navarro Research & Engineering is an award-winning federal contractor dedicated to partnering with clients to advance clean energy and deliver effective solutions for complex challenges in the nuclear and environmental fields. Joining Navarro means being a part of an exceptional team committed to quality and safety while also looking for innovative strategies to create value for the client’s success. Headquartered in Oak Ridge, Tennessee, Navarro has active programs in place across the nation for DOE/NNSA, NASA, and the Department of Defense.

As the Program Manager, you will play a critical role in the development, implementation, and execution of the Supply Chain Field Organization which manages the ACO supply chain.

What You Will Do:

Key responsibilities include leading a cross functional team to optimize supplier reliability and quality performance, identifies and facilitates the review and qualification of new suppliers, drives continuous improvement within the supply chain, mitigates supply chain risks by establishing contingency plans, identifying opportunities to optimize manufacturing processes to reduce costs, and monitors and maintain metrics to measure supply chain performance.

Requirements

Bachelor of Science in Engineering, Business, or Supply Chain Management

8-10 Years of Related Experience

Proficient in Microsoft products, specifically Microsoft Excel, Word, and PowerPoint

Organizational skills to handle multiple tasks within high pressure work site environment.

Working knowledge of end-to-end Supply Chain processes and principles

A Successful Candidate Brings:

Strong Analytical Skills: To analyze information, data, and identify potential issues or opportunities

Problem-Solving Skills: To develop creative solutions to challenges that arise

Communication Skills: To effectively communicate with team members, stakeholders, and clients.

Technical skills: Working knowledge of machine shop manufacturing processes

Leadership Skills: To motivate and guide team members.
